Cool Camp for Cool Kids!

By Ruby Stephenson, Community Writer
December 19, 2024 at 07:40am. Views: 195

What’s cooler than cool? Winter Day Camp, of course! Participants enjoy a variety of art projects, games, sports, and much more in a supervised, fun-filled environment. Space is limited, so register now.

 

About the Camp:

·     Winter Session 1: – December 23, 26, 27

Cost: $81 Residents | $105 Non-Residents

·     Winter Session 2: – December 30 - January 3

Cost $108 Residents | $140 Non-Residents

·     Winter Session 3: – January 6-10

Cost $135 Residents | $176 Non-Residents

·     For Ages 5-12.

·     Two snacks provided. Campers must come with a prepared lunch.

·     New participants must register in person at the Conference & Recreation Center located at 14075 Frederick St. and provide birth certificate verification.

 

Previous campers may register at www.registermoval.org. Call 951.413.3280 or email camps@moval.org for more info
